Brick tuckpointing services involve repairing and restoring the mortar joints between bricks on a building’s exterior. Over time, exposure to weather and general aging can cause mortar to crack, crumble, or deteriorate. Tuckpointing involves carefully removing the damaged mortar and replacing it with fresh, matching mortar to improve the appearance and structural integrity of the brickwork. This process not only enhances the visual appeal of a property but also helps prevent further damage that could lead to more costly repairs down the line.
This service is particularly useful for addressing common problems such as crumbling mortar, cracks, gaps, or loose bricks. When mortar begins to deteriorate, it can allow water infiltration, which may lead to more serious issues like mold, interior damage, or even foundational concerns. Tuckpointing helps seal these vulnerabilities, protecting the building from moisture intrusion and maintaining its stability. It is often recommended for older properties or buildings that show signs of wear, ensuring they remain safe and visually appealing.
Brick tuckpointing is frequently performed on residential homes, especially those with brick facades or chimneys that have experienced years of exposure to the elements. It is also common on historic buildings, apartment complexes, and commercial properties that require preservation of their brickwork. Property owners who notice crumbling mortar, efflorescence, or water stains on their exterior walls may find that tuckpointing is a practical solution to restore both the look and function of their brick surfaces.

The overview below groups typical Brick Tuckpointing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Manassas,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tuckpointing work on small sections of brickwork gener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and accessibility.
Moderate Projects - Larger, more involved tuckpointing jobs, such as restoring an entire facade or multiple walls, can c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to improve curb appeal or address ongoing deterioration.
Full Wall Replacements - Complete brick wall replacements or extensive tuckpointing over large areas may reach $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this high-tier range, typically reserved for significant structural repairs or historic building restoration.
Complex or Historic Restorations - Highly detailed or complex projects, including matching original mortar styles or working on historic structures, can exceed $10,000. These jobs are less frequent but necessary for specialized restoration work in the Manassas area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is tuckpointing for brick structures? Tuckpointing involves repairing and restoring the mortar joints between bricks to improve appearance and structural integrity.
Why should I consider tuckpointing services? Tuckpointing helps prevent water infiltration, reduces damage from weather, and maintains the value of brick buildings.
How do local contractors handle tuckpointing projects? Experienced service providers assess the condition of the mortar, carefully remove damaged material, and apply fresh mortar to match the existing brickwork.
What are signs that brick mortar needs repair? Cracked, crumbling, or missing mortar, as well as visible gaps or deterioration around bricks, indicate that tuckpointing may be needed.
Can tuckpointing improve the appearance of my brickwork? Yes, properly performed tuckpointing can enhance the look of brick surfaces by restoring clean, uniform mortar joints.
